About

Our lodge is situated in the heart of beautiful Northern Ireland for our visitors to access all parts of the Provence. We have bed and breakfast and self-catering facilities. Lurgan West lodge is located at the top of Lough Neagh on the outskirts of the historic village of Randalstown, only 5 minutes walk from pubs restaurants and shops. Our location is ideal for easy access to Belfast International and Belfast City Airports. Rail Links to Belfast, Ballymena, Coleraine, Portrush, Portstewart, Derry and beyond.
